Essential Breastfeeding Concepts: Understanding the Basics

Breastfeeding, the natural nourishment for your precious little one, is not just about milk; it's a miraculous symphony of nutritional gold, immunity-boosting powerhouses, and an unbreakable emotional bond. Let's dive into some key terms to help you navigate this beautiful journey with confidence.

  • Lactation: Picture your body as a magic milk factory, producing the perfect liquid nourishment tailored specifically for your baby. This magical process is called lactation, orchestrated by your incredible hormones.

  • Immunity: Breast milk is not just nourishment; it's a superhero elixir that shields your baby from invaders. It's teeming with antibodies and immune cells, tirelessly fighting off germs and boosting your baby's defenses.

  • Nutritional Benefits: From the moment your baby latches on, they're gulping down a nutritional jackpot. Breast milk is a perfect blend of protein, fat, carbohydrates, vitamins, and minerals, providing everything your growing star needs for optimal development.
